Nancy Pelosi

The Public Record

Nancy Patricia Pelosi is an American politician serving as the Speaker of the United States House of Representatives since January 2019, and previously from 2007 to 2011. She is a member of the Democratic Party and has represented California's 12th congressional district in the House of Representatives since 1987, making her one of the longest-serving members of Congress. Pelosi is the first woman to hold the office of Speaker, a role in which she has played a significant part in shaping legislative priorities and party strategy.
